Panic as gunmen attack Kaduna-Abuja Train
On Thursday, gunmen attacked an Abuja-bound train near Katari village in Kagarko Local Government Area of Kaduna State.
Onyxnewsng reports that Punch gathered that the train, which left the Rigasa Train Station, was attacked 10 in the morning at Katari, close to Abuja.
According to a source, the windows of Coach SP12 attached to the train were shattered by bullets from the gunmen’ shooting, but no life was lost.
“Coach SP 12 attached to the train from Kaduna was shattered by gunshots.
“There was panic everywhere among the passengers. It was something that nobody could explain at the moment but we are trusting in God that something be done by security operatives to curtail this unfortunate incident,” the source said.
Although, the police are yet to confirm the attack.
